xtd 0.2.0
Loading...
Searching...
No Matches
xtd::drawing::native::graphics Member List

This is the complete list of members for xtd::drawing::native::graphics, including all inherited members.

clear(intptr handle, xtd::byte a, xtd::byte r, xtd::byte g, xtd::byte b)xtd::drawing::native::graphicsprotectedstatic
clip(intptr handle, intptr region)xtd::drawing::native::graphicsprotectedstatic
compositing_mode(intptr handle, int32 compositing_mode)xtd::drawing::native::graphicsprotectedstatic
compositing_quality(intptr handle, int32 compositing_quality)xtd::drawing::native::graphicsprotectedstatic
copy_from_graphics(intptr handle, intptr handle_source, int32 source_x, int32 source_y, int32 destination_x, int32 destination_y, int32 block_region_width, int32 block_region_height, int32 copy_pixel_operation)xtd::drawing::native::graphicsprotectedstatic
copy_from_screen(intptr handle, int32 source_x, int32 source_y, int32 destination_x, int32 destination_y, int32 block_region_width, int32 block_region_height, int32 copy_pixel_operation)xtd::drawing::native::graphicsprotectedstatic
destroy(intptr handle)xtd::drawing::native::graphicsprotectedstatic
draw_arc(intptr handle, intptr pen, float x, float y, float width, float height, float start_angle, float sweep_angle)xtd::drawing::native::graphicsprotectedstatic
draw_bezier(intptr handle, intptr pen, float x1, float y1, float x2, float y2, float x3, float y3, float x4, float y4)xtd::drawing::native::graphicsprotectedstatic
draw_beziers(intptr handle, intptr pen, const std::vector< xtd::collections::generic::key_value_pair< float, float > > &points)xtd::drawing::native::graphicsprotectedstatic
draw_closed_curve(intptr handle, intptr pen, std::vector< xtd::collections::generic::key_value_pair< float, float > > points, float tension)xtd::drawing::native::graphicsprotectedstatic
draw_curve(intptr handle, intptr pen, std::vector< xtd::collections::generic::key_value_pair< float, float > > points, float tension)xtd::drawing::native::graphicsprotectedstatic
draw_ellipse(intptr handle, intptr pen, float x, float y, float width, float heigh)xtd::drawing::native::graphicsprotectedstatic
draw_image(intptr handle, intptr image, float x, float y, float width, float height)xtd::drawing::native::graphicsprotectedstatic
draw_image(intptr handle, intptr image, float dest_x, float dest_y, float dest_width, float dest_height, float src_x, float src_y, float src_width, float src_height)xtd::drawing::native::graphicsprotectedstatic
draw_image_disabled(intptr handle, intptr image, float x, float y, float width, float height, float brightness)xtd::drawing::native::graphicsprotectedstatic
draw_line(intptr handle, intptr pen, float x1, float y1, float x2, float y2)xtd::drawing::native::graphicsprotectedstatic
draw_lines(intptr handle, intptr pen, const std::vector< xtd::collections::generic::key_value_pair< float, float > > &points)xtd::drawing::native::graphicsprotectedstatic
draw_path(intptr handle, intptr pen, intptr graphics_path)xtd::drawing::native::graphicsprotectedstatic
draw_pie(intptr handle, intptr pen, float x, float y, float width, float height, float start_angle, float sweep_angle)xtd::drawing::native::graphicsprotectedstatic
draw_polygon(intptr handle, intptr pen, const std::vector< xtd::collections::generic::key_value_pair< float, float > > &points)xtd::drawing::native::graphicsprotectedstatic
draw_rectangle(intptr handle, intptr pen, float x, float y, float width, float height)xtd::drawing::native::graphicsprotectedstatic
draw_rectangles(intptr handle, intptr pen, std::vector< std::tuple< float, float, float, float > > &rects)xtd::drawing::native::graphicsprotectedstatic
draw_rotated_string(intptr handle, const xtd::string &text, intptr font, intptr brush, float x, float y, float angle)xtd::drawing::native::graphicsprotectedstatic
draw_rounded_rectangle(intptr handle, intptr pen, float x, float y, float width, float height, float radius)xtd::drawing::native::graphicsprotectedstatic
draw_string(intptr handle, const xtd::string &text, intptr font, intptr brush, float x, float y, int32 alignment, int32 line_alignment, int32 hot_key_prefix, int32 trimming)xtd::drawing::native::graphicsprotectedstatic
draw_string(intptr handle, const xtd::string &text, intptr font, intptr brush, float x, float y, float width, float height, int32 alignment, int32 line_alignment, int32 hot_key_prefix, int32 trimming, int32 string_formats)xtd::drawing::native::graphicsprotectedstatic
fill_closed_curve(intptr handle, intptr brush, std::vector< xtd::collections::generic::key_value_pair< float, float > > points, uint32 fill_mode, float tension)xtd::drawing::native::graphicsprotectedstatic
fill_ellipse(intptr handle, intptr brush, float x, float y, float width, float heigh)xtd::drawing::native::graphicsprotectedstatic
fill_path(intptr handle, intptr brush, intptr graphics_path, int32 mode)xtd::drawing::native::graphicsprotectedstatic
fill_pie(intptr handle, intptr brush, float x, float y, float width, float height, float start_angle, float sweep_angle)xtd::drawing::native::graphicsprotectedstatic
fill_polygon(intptr handle, intptr pen, const std::vector< xtd::collections::generic::key_value_pair< float, float > > &points, int32 fill_mode)xtd::drawing::native::graphicsprotectedstatic
fill_rectangle(intptr handle, intptr brush, float x, float y, float width, float height)xtd::drawing::native::graphicsprotectedstatic
fill_rectangles(intptr handle, intptr brush, std::vector< std::tuple< float, float, float, float > > &rects)xtd::drawing::native::graphicsprotectedstatic
fill_region(intptr handle, intptr brush, intptr region)xtd::drawing::native::graphicsprotectedstatic
fill_rounded_rectangle(intptr handle, intptr brush, float x, float y, float width, float height, float radius)xtd::drawing::native::graphicsprotectedstatic
flush(intptr handle, int32 intention)xtd::drawing::native::graphicsprotectedstatic
from_hdc(intptr hdc)xtd::drawing::native::graphicsprotectedstatic
from_hdc(intptr hdc, intptr hdevice)xtd::drawing::native::graphicsprotectedstatic
from_hwnd(intptr hwnd)xtd::drawing::native::graphicsprotectedstatic
from_image(intptr image)xtd::drawing::native::graphicsprotectedstatic
get_dpi_x(intptr handle)xtd::drawing::native::graphicsprotectedstatic
get_dpi_y(intptr handle)xtd::drawing::native::graphicsprotectedstatic
get_hdc(intptr handle)xtd::drawing::native::graphicsprotectedstatic
get_nearest_color(intptr handle, xtd::byte original_a, xtd::byte original_r, xtd::byte original_g, xtd::byte original_b, xtd::byte &nearest_a, xtd::byte &nearest_r, xtd::byte &nearest_g, xtd::byte &nearest_b)xtd::drawing::native::graphicsprotectedstatic
interpolation_mode(intptr handle, int32 interpolation_mode)xtd::drawing::native::graphicsprotectedstatic
measure_string(intptr handle, const xtd::string &text, intptr font, float &width, float &height, float max_width, float max_height, int32 alignment, int32 line_alignment, int32 hot_key_prefix, int32 trimming, size_t characters_fitted, size_t lines_filled, bool measure_trailing_spaces)xtd::drawing::native::graphicsprotectedstatic
pixel_offset_mode(intptr handle, int32 pixel_offst_mode)xtd::drawing::native::graphicsprotectedstatic
release_hdc(intptr handle, intptr hdc)xtd::drawing::native::graphicsprotectedstatic
reset_transform(intptr handle)xtd::drawing::native::graphicsprotectedstatic
restore(intptr handle, intptr &gstate)xtd::drawing::native::graphicsprotectedstatic
rotate_transform(intptr handle, float angle, int32 order)xtd::drawing::native::graphicsprotectedstatic
save(intptr handle)xtd::drawing::native::graphicsprotectedstatic
scale_transform(intptr handle, float sx, float sy, int32 order)xtd::drawing::native::graphicsprotectedstatic
smoothing_mode(intptr handle, int32 smoothing_mode)xtd::drawing::native::graphicsprotectedstatic
text_contrast(intptr handle, int32 text_contrast)xtd::drawing::native::graphicsprotectedstatic
text_rendering_hint(intptr handle, int32 text_rendering_hint)xtd::drawing::native::graphicsprotectedstatic
transform(intptr handle)xtd::drawing::native::graphicsprotectedstatic
transform(intptr handle, intptr matrix)xtd::drawing::native::graphicsprotectedstatic
translate_transform(intptr handle, float dx, float dy, int32 order)xtd::drawing::native::graphicsprotectedstatic
trim_string(intptr handle, const xtd::string &text, intptr font, float width, int32 trimming)xtd::drawing::native::graphicsprotectedstatic
visible_clip_bounds(intptr handle, float &x, float &y, float &width, float &height)xtd::drawing::native::graphicsprotectedstatic